Transaction 29fdb63e030db5a5986410a6232dd6c8bf47aaa8600bca002ea5111717ff3507
1 Input
2 Outputs
- 29fdb63e030db5a5986410a6232dd6c8bf47aaa8600bca002ea5111717ff3507:0
- 29fdb63e030db5a5986410a6232dd6c8bf47aaa8600bca002ea5111717ff3507:1
value 2675539
address 15ibyxQiKoHaLwsHwxnCwHwXvwmhZSicjV
value 2234961
address 1EXYJnNLMTRpjnFFF66ttyixhPnoKRoY4i